Why Malawi Needs Advanced Photovoltaic Energy Storage

With only 18% of Malawi's population connected to the national grid (World Bank, 2023), solar energy storage systems are no longer optional – they're a lifeline. The country's photovoltaic sector grew 27% year-on-year in 2022, driven by:

  • Frequent grid outages lasting 6-8 hours daily in urban areas
  • 65% of rural clinics relying entirely on solar+storage systems
  • New tax incentives for commercial solar installations

Technical Challenges in Malawi's Solar Storage Market

Think Malawi's climate is just about sunshine? Think again. Manufacturers must overcome:

  • Dust storms: Reduce panel efficiency by up to 29% monthly
  • High humidity: 80% average RH accelerates corrosion
  • Voltage fluctuations: 15% wider range than European standards

3 Key Considerations When Choosing a Manufacturer

  1. Localized testing: Does the battery chemistry suit Malawi's climate?
  2. After-sales support: Average technician response time in Africa?
  3. Scalability: Can systems grow with your energy needs?

Pro Tip: Look for IP65-rated enclosures and active thermal management – these features increase system lifespan by 40% in tropical conditions.

The Road Ahead: Malawi's Energy Storage Future

With 83 MW of new solar projects approved in Q1 2024 alone, storage solutions must evolve. Emerging trends include:

  • Hybrid systems combining solar with wind/diesel
  • Blockchain-enabled energy sharing between microgrids
  • AI-driven predictive maintenance

Frequently Asked Questions

Q: How long do solar batteries last in Malawi's climate? A: Quality lithium batteries typically last 8-12 years with proper maintenance.

Q: What's the payback period for a commercial system? A: Most businesses recover costs in 2.5-4 years through fuel savings and increased productivity.
